Abstract
A method of producing an iridescent reflecting surface on an object is presented. Flakes of dry non metallic reflecting material such as cholesteric liquid crystal (CLC) material are applied to the surface so that the flakes are parallel with the surface and bound with a binder to the surface.

55 . A method of producing a pattern on a surface of a substrate, the method comprising:
applying a patterned coat of a binder material to the surface of a substrate using a printer selected from the group consisting of flexo press, off-set, gravure and screen; and applying a dry pigment material to the surface of the binder material, the pigment material adhering to the binder material;
56 . The method of claim 55 further comprising:
repeating application a patterned coal of a binder material and a dry pigment material a plurality of times to build up a multipigmented pattern.
57 . The method of claim 55 wherein the binder material comprises a fluid material.
58 . The method of claim 55 wherein the binder material comprises a fusible material.
59 . The method of claim 55 wherein the binder material comprises a radiation curable material.
60 . The method of claim 55 wherein the binder material comprises a mixture, the mixture comprising a non-volatile and a volatile solvent.
61 . The method of claim 55 further comprising:
mechanically working the surface of the binder to align the flakes in a direction that is substantially parallel thereto.
62 . The method of claim 61 wherein mechanically working comprises rolling the surface of the binder material.
63 . The method of claim 61 wherein mechanically working comprises buffing the surface of the binder material.
64 . The method of claim 55 wherein the dry pigment material comprises flakes of cholesteric liquid crystal material.
65 . The method of claim 64 wherein the flakes of cholesteric liquid crystal material comprise a non-linear pitch distribution to reflect a broad band of light.
66 . The method of claim 55 further comprising:
